Carey Sowle is the Chief Operating Officer for Solana, a Wauseon, Ohio based software company. Solana is a for-profit subsidiary of Sunshine Communities, Inc. a local agency serving individ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ities. Solana provides enterprise resource planning software and solutions for agencies like Sunshine Communities across the United States. As COO Carey leads the implementation, support, and business services teams. She has held this position since 2007.

Carey graduated from Lake Superior State University with a bachelor’s degree in computer science and secondary education. She has an extensive background in the field of intellectual and developmental disabilities; both in direct support and leadership positions. At Solana, Carey and her team have assisted more than 130 agencies across the country with software implementation and ongoing support. One of Carey’s primary focuses is providing an exceptional customer experiance. Her team consistently scores above average on the Net Promoter Score index, a rating system that measures customer satisfaction.
